Yard & Garden Lighting Options for Woodbridge Properties

Every property is different, and effective yard lighting is never one-size-fits-all. We design lighting scenes suited to the unique layout of your home, from the front curb to the back fence line, using low-voltage LED lighting systems sized and positioned for each application.

Front Yard & Entry Lighting

In the front yard, we often use architectural uplighting on stonework, columns, or rooflines to give the home presence from the street. Soft illumination along driveways and entry walks makes it easier for guests to find your door and reduces shadows that can hide steps or obstacles. The result is an approach that feels inviting from the street and comfortable on arrival.

Backyard & Patio Lighting

For backyards and patios, we focus on creating usable outdoor living spaces after dark. This can include lighting around seating areas, decks, and grilling zones, along with accents on trees or fences that frame the space. The right combination of task lighting and softer ambient light can make gatherings feel relaxed rather than harsh.

Garden & Landscape Bed Lighting

Garden and landscape beds benefit from accent lighting that brings out color, shape, and texture. We may use uplighting on specimen trees, gentle washes on low plantings, or subtle lighting around water features including fountains. Done well, garden lighting adds depth and visual interest and helps keep your landscape a focal point well after dark.

Landscape Lighting Built for Woodbridge Homes & Climate

Homes in Woodbridge range from classic single-family houses with generous front lawns to townhomes with compact entries and wooded backyards. Woodbridge is a census-designated place in Prince William County, approximately 20 miles south of Washington, D.C., with housing stock spanning subdivisions built from the 1970s through the 2000s alongside newer waterfront communities. We design for that variety rather than working from a single template.

The climate here brings humid summers, significant rainfall, and winter conditions that can stress outdoor fixtures. We use solid copper and brass path lights and spotlights that are built for four-season outdoor exposure and patina over time with a beautiful verdigris finish, blending seamlessly into the landscape. These aren’t fixtures that quickly degrade after a few seasons. They age gracefully through the conditions Prince William County properties see year after year.

Mature trees, sloped lots, and close neighbors are common in this area, and each affects lighting design. We pay attention to where light can travel, how it reflects off surfaces, and how to avoid unwanted glare into your windows or a neighbor’s home.
